Founded by local citizens in 1893, CCHS’s early years were occupied with collecting items of historical value, dedicating historical markers and searching for a permanent home. Those years created the nucleus of today’s extensive library collections, which today include over 500,000 manuscripts, 20,000 volumes, and what one author in National Genealogical Society Quarterly called “one of the state’s best collections of newspaper clippings.” The library collections are complemented by permanent and changing museum exhibits, as well as 100,000 historic photographs preserved in the Photo Archives.
